-----Mensaje original----- De: [EMAIL PROTECTED] [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]]En nombre de Oracle DBA Enviado el: Saturday, 05 January, 2002 7:35 AM Para: Multiple recipients of list ORACLE-L Asunto: nls_date_format in 8.1.6 we have set nls_date_format to dd-mm-yyyy in parameter file . but all the funtions which have some hard coded date value in the format of dd-mm-yyyy are giving "not a valid month error" example is create or replace function test_bkj(t_date date) return varchar2 is begin if (t_date < '12-12-2001') then t_retval := 'Less Than'; else t_retval := 'Greater Than'; end if; return t_retval; end; SQL> select test_bkj('12-12-2001') from dual; select test_bkj('12-12-2001') from dual * ERROR at line 1: ORA-01843: not a valid month ORA-06512: at "AVLMKT.TEST_BKJ", line 6 ORA-06512: at line 1 when we change the date format in funtion to 'dd/MON/yyyy' keeping the nls_date_format to 'dd-mm-yyyy' we are getting wrong results from function . create or replace function test_bkj(t_date date) return varchar2 is begin if (t_date < '12-DEC-2001') then t_retval := 'Less Than'; else t_retval := 'Greater Than'; end if; return t_retval; end; SQL> select test_bkj('31-12-2001') from dual; TEST_BKJ('31/12/2001') 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- ---- Less Than while the results should have been "Greater than" . ............(pl see the if-else condition ) its giving "Less Than" for any date comparison.
